It’s easy to forget Washington state is blessed with such diverse landscapes when nearly all of my time is spent in the Cascades. I only read about White Bluffs recently after seeing photos of sand dunes in a report. Who knew sand dunes existed in this part of the state?!

Pups and I explored the north slope of White Bluffs on an extremely windy day in fall. Apart from the larger-than-life white bluffs, the several large, wind-blown sand dunes added even more drama to the already impressive landscape. Skies were also full of dramatic colors near day’s end.
